Output e914f5a01eed3e195a8d1bb5611c3f6c63473bfd2f29aa639a4d4aec519b6f3d:1

value
58267033
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cb4c7589061b9191fdc672c3ef799ab9df07c3b OP_EQUAL
address
37E12n3qJhJYXXgpLyFP99MKd1TLEeCdyE
transaction
e914f5a01eed3e195a8d1bb5611c3f6c63473bfd2f29aa639a4d4aec519b6f3d
confirmations
381412
spent
true